Output c41159d329adeb5f537fd24e5bf9dc20efbbf78f2de1c1aebb53e59d4f5079f8:3

value
1232548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c7ecd0c5001817641c2721470249aa91707486 OP_EQUAL
address
35moA2AzGEiKtCXozvrDwu72czhVHmCg56
transaction
c41159d329adeb5f537fd24e5bf9dc20efbbf78f2de1c1aebb53e59d4f5079f8
confirmations
325480
spent
true